Nine DELTA Group Companies Achieve Level 1 B-BBEE Status

With Delta Built Environment Consultants (Delta BEC) being re-certified as a Level 1 Broad-Based Black Economic Empowerment (B-BBEE) contributor and eight of the other companies in the group achieving Level 1 B-BBEE status for the first time, the DELTA Group now has a total of nine companies that have achieved this rating.

The DELTA Group comprises 18 vertically integrated companies operating in the built environment, undertaking the funding, design development, operation and maintenance of infrastructure and facilities. Delta BEC—the group’s 52% black-owned multi-disciplinary consulting company—was recently re-awarded Level 1 BEE status by BEE Verification Agency CC.

After achieving a total of 102.85 out of a target score of 106 in the assessment, seven subsidiaries also achieved Level 1 BEE status with the re-certification of Delta BEC. Delta BEC and its sister companies obtained scores of 24.00 for ownership and 11.59 for management control. Moreover, the companies achieved actual scores of 33.21 for skills development, 28.05 for preferential procurement and supplier development, and 6.00 for socio-economic development, surpassing the target score for each of these elements. As a result, the following companies forming part of the DELTA Group were awarded Level 1 B-BBEE status for the first time and recognised for their contribution to economic transformation in South Africa:

  • Delta Café

  • Delta Cleaning and Hygiene

  • Delta IT Services

  • Delta Landscaping Services

  • Delta Waste Management

  • D-Con

  • Delta Facilities Management

  • Delta Infrastructure Solutions.

The DELTA Group continues its commitment to transformation and empowering the historically disadvantaged in South Africa following the successful Level 1 B-BBEE certification of the aforementioned companies and re-certification of Delta BEC as it aims to have more of its companies certified.
